How many mail messages do you receive per day? How many news
articles would you read per day? Chances are that you will
read lots more in news.
You won't likely post a lot. There were only 546 posts from all of
Engineering in the last 11 days, most of them quite small. Compare
that to the more than four gigabytes of news we read over the same period.
If we open up news access to offstream students with lots of time on
their hands, that news reading number will be even larger.
Will news access *replace* your Email reading? Probably not.
It will also cause you to spend much more time connected, meaning
there will always be more people connected, thus driving up that
thing we annoyingly call load.
I am looking at options for uw.* newsgroups, but other news access
really pushes up our costs deliverring this service.
